Margaret Rose
Crayne
July 18, 1935 – April 19, 2026
Margaret Rose Crayne, lovingly known as Rose, passed away on Sunday, April 19, 2026, after a long and meaningful life. She was born on July 18, 1935, in Dalry, Scotland, to Nicandro and Mary Dollan Arcaro.
In 1959, Rose married Donald and embraced the life of a military wife, building a strong and loving home wherever life took them. Over 62 years of marriage, they raised five daughters who were the pride and joy of her life: Donna Robinson (Marty), Darla Mangels (Martin), Lesa Crayne (Bob), Sherry Grayson (Ed) and Angela Stull (Randy).
Rose was, at her core, a giver. She found joy in sharing with others, gardening, and watching her favorite shows, often offering her own spirited commentary on the plots and characters. She had a deep love for animals, and many cherished stories remain of her furry companions throughout the years - most especially her beloved Bella.
Rose is preceded in death by her husband, Donald Crayne; her parents, and her siblings Andrew, Mary, Dominic, Felix, Edward, and Rizzio.
In addition to her daughters, Rose is survived by six grandchildren: Ryan Stanley (Alina), Jacob Stanley, Michelle Burton (Brett), Amanda Williams (Dane), Taylor Stull and Patrick Dolan, and nine great-grandchildren: Jennifer, Victoria, Jaxson, Kolten, Jace, Noel, Tyler, Zachary and Luke. After a long and full life, Rose leaves behind a legacy of kindness, warmth, and devotion to family. She will be deeply missed and forever remembered by those who loved her.
Private family graveside services will be held at Barrancas National Cemetery.
The family extends their heartfelt gratitude to the staff at the Arbors Memory Care facility, and Rachelle and her team with Select Physical Therapy.
